For any real numbers … WebFormula for Commutative Property of Multiplication-. a*b=b*a. For example: take 1*2. We know that 1*2=2. Here, 2 is the final result. Now, if we change the order of operands, then it will be 2*1. We also know—> 2*1=2 Here also, 2 is the final result.
